The Art Gallery at Rivier University presents Pairings exhibition

The Art Gallery at Rivier University is hosting an exhibition of Pairings from February 10 to May 1.

Featuring two artworks of varying media presented side by side, and introducing a new pairing each week, the exhibition encourages visitors to pause and engage more deeply, fostering a richer appreciation of the art directly in front of them.

Drawing primarily from the University’s permanent collection, the exhibition welcomes visitors with two striking works displayed at the center of the gallery. Three thoughtfully arranged chairs invite guests to sit, reflect, and spend meaningful time with the pieces. A digital slideshow complements each weekly pairing, offering expanded context including artist biographies, insights into the creative process, and information on the techniques used to bring them to life.

In a space filled with art, even the most curious viewers can experience visual overload and skim the artworks too quickly. By presenting the collection in carefully curated segments over several weeks and providing insightful written commentary for personal reflection, The Art Gallery aims to cultivate a deeper understanding of each piece and the thoughtful dialogues that emerge between them.

Pairings is inspired by a long-time estimate that the average time spent looking at a single artwork is 30 seconds,” says Sr. Theresa Couture, Gallery Director. “In response, The Art Gallery is experimenting with showing only two at a time, with the twosomes presented as deliberate, but not necessarily obvious, pairs.”

Whether connected by subject matter, medium, craftsmanship, style, purpose, history, or artistic insight, each pairing reveals how artworks can illuminate and enrich one another when placed in conversation.
